JUSTICE JITENDRA MOHAN SHARMA ORAL ORDER 10-08-2016 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and learned counsel representing the State.
The petitioner wants to renew his prayer of bail, which was earlier rejected vide order dated 25.01.2016 passed in Cr. Misc. No. 29664 of 2015, on the ground that the petitioner is in custody since 04.09.2015 and up-till now the trial has not been concluded and in near future it is not likely to be concluded to which learned APP opposes by submitting that the petitioner is also the assailant and in the post mortem report so many injuries were found on the person of the deceased.
In the facts and circumstances stated above, finding no good ground for reconsideration of prayer for bail of the petitioner, again his prayer for bail stands rejected. However, learned trial court is directed to expedite the trial and conclude the same as early as possible, preferably within four
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.27996 of 2016 (3) dt.10-08-2016 months from the date of receipt/production of a copy of this order, failing which the petitioner, if at no fault, may be at liberty to renew his prayer of bail before the court below itself. (Jitendra Mohan Sharma, J) avin/- U T
